Formate-Mediated C-C Coupling of Aryl/Vinyl Halides and Triflates: Carbonyl Arylation and Reductive Cross-Coupling
Yu-Hsiang Chang1, Yoon Cho1, Weijia Shen1
1University of Texas at Austin, Department of Chemistry Welch Hall (A5300), 105 E 24th St., Austin, TX 78712, USA.
Abstract:
Catalytic methods for the intermolecular formate-mediated C-C coupling of Csp2-X pronucleophiles beyond reductive Heck reactions (alkene hydroarylations) are catalogued. These methods include transfer hydrogenative reductive couplings of aryl/vinyl halides or triflates to carbonyl compounds (Grignard/NHK-type reactions), as well as reductive cross-couplings of two aryl/vinyl halide or triflate partners. These studies demonstrate that reactions traditionally associated with discrete Csp2 carbanions can be rendered catalytic and free from premetalated reagents or metallic reductants using sodium or potassium formate - abundant, low molecular weight sources of hydrogen.
